Yersinia-Associated Osteomyelitis: A Comprehensive Guide
Overview
Yersinia-associated osteomyelitis is a rare but serious bone infection caused by bacteria from the Yersinia genus, most commonly Yersinia enterocolitica or Yersinia pseudotuberculosis. These bacteria typically cause gastrointestinal infections, but in rare cases, they can spread to the bones, leading to osteomyelitis—a painful and potentially debilitating condition.
Who Does It Affect?
This condition most commonly affects:
- Children and adolescents, particularly those with weakened immune systems.
- Individuals with underlying health conditions, such as diabetes, liver disease, or iron overload disorders (e.g., hemochromatosis).
- People with sickle cell disease, who are at higher risk for bone infections due to impaired blood flow.
- Those with recent gastrointestinal infections caused by Yersinia bacteria.
Prevalence
Osteomyelitis caused by Yersinia is extremely rare. Yersinia enterocolitica is responsible for about 1-2% of all bacterial osteomyelitis cases in children, according to a study published in The Pediatric Infectious Disease Journal (source). Most cases occur in regions where Yersinia infections are more common, such as Europe and North America.
Symptoms
Symptoms of Yersinia-associated osteomyelitis can develop gradually or suddenly, depending on the severity of the infection. Common signs include:
Localized Symptoms (Affected Bone Area)
- Pain: Persistent, deep pain in the affected bone, often worsening at night or with movement.
- Swelling: Redness, warmth, and swelling over the infected area.
- Tenderness: The bone or surrounding tissue may be tender to touch.
- Limited mobility: Difficulty moving the affected limb or joint.
Systemic Symptoms (Whole Body)
- Fever: Often low-grade but can spike in severe cases.
- Fatigue: Generalized weakness or malaise.
- Chills and sweating: Indicative of a systemic infection.
- Nausea or loss of appetite: Due to the body's inflammatory response.
Symptoms in Children
In children, symptoms may also include:
- Irritability or unexplained crying (in infants).
- Reluctance to bear weight on the affected limb (e.g., limping).
- Swelling or tenderness in the long bones (e.g., femur, tibia).
Note: Symptoms may resemble other conditions, such as arthritis or trauma-related pain. A healthcare provider should evaluate persistent bone pain, especially if accompanied by fever or swelling.
Causes and Risk Factors
Causes
Yersinia-associated osteomyelitis occurs when Yersinia bacteria enter the bloodstream (bacteremia) and travel to the bone. The infection can originate from:
- Gastrointestinal infections: Consuming contaminated food or water (e.g., undercooked pork, unpasteurized milk).
- Direct inoculation: Rarely, bacteria may enter through an open wound or surgical site.
- Bloodstream spread: From another infected site in the body.
Risk Factors
Certain factors increase the likelihood of developing this condition:
- Weakened immune system: Due to HIV/AIDS, chemotherapy, or immunosuppressive medications.
- Chronic illnesses: Such as diabetes, liver disease, or kidney failure.
- Iron overload disorders: Yersinia thrives in iron-rich environments, making individuals with hemochromatosis or those receiving iron infusions more susceptible.
- Sickle cell disease: Impaired blood flow increases the risk of bone infections.
- Recent gastrointestinal infection: Especially if caused by Yersinia.
- Young age: Children under 5 are at higher risk due to their developing immune systems.
Diagnosis
Diagnosing Yersinia-associated osteomyelitis requires a combination of clinical evaluation, imaging, and laboratory tests.
Medical History and Physical Exam
Your doctor will ask about:
- Recent illnesses, particularly gastrointestinal symptoms (e.g., diarrhea, abdominal pain).
- History of chronic conditions or immune suppression.
- Location, duration, and severity of bone pain.
Laboratory Tests
- Blood cultures: To identify Yersinia bacteria in the bloodstream.
- Complete blood count (CBC): Elevated white blood cell count may indicate infection.
- Erythrocyte sedimentation rate (ESR) and C-reactive protein (CRP): Inflammatory markers that are often elevated in osteomyelitis.
- Stool culture: If a recent gastrointestinal infection is suspected.
Imaging Studies
- X-rays: May show bone damage in later stages but can appear normal early in the infection.
- MRI (Magnetic Resonance Imaging): The gold standard for diagnosing osteomyelitis, as it can detect early changes in bone and soft tissue.
- CT scan: Useful for assessing bone destruction or abscesses.
- Bone scan: Involves injecting a radioactive tracer to highlight infected areas.
Bone Biopsy
In some cases, a bone biopsy may be performed to confirm the diagnosis. A small sample of bone or fluid is extracted and cultured to identify the specific bacteria causing the infection.
Treatment Options
Treatment for Yersinia-associated osteomyelitis typically involves a combination of antibiotics and, in severe cases, surgical intervention.
Antibiotics
Yersinia infections are usually treated with antibiotics effective against Gram-negative bacteria. Common choices include:
- Fluoroquinolones (e.g., ciprofloxacin).
- Third-generation cephalosporins (e.g., ceftriaxone).
- Aminoglycosides (e.g., gentamicin) in severe cases.
- Trimethoprim-sulfamethoxazole (TMP-SMX) for susceptible strains.
Duration: Antibiotics are typically administered intravenously (IV) for 2-6 weeks, followed by oral antibiotics for several more weeks. The total duration depends on the severity of the infection and the patient's response to treatment.
Surgical Intervention
Surgery may be necessary if:
- An abscess (pocket of pus) has formed in the bone or surrounding tissue.
- There is significant bone damage or dead bone tissue (sequestrum) that needs removal.
- The infection does not respond to antibiotics alone.
Surgical options include:
- Drainage: Removing pus or fluid from the infected area.
- Debridement: Removing infected or dead bone tissue.
- Bone grafting: In cases of extensive bone loss, healthy bone may be transplanted to promote healing.
Supportive Care
- Pain management: Over-the-counter pain relievers (e.g., ibuprofen, acetaminophen) or prescription medications for severe pain.
- Immobilization: Using a cast, brace, or splint to protect the affected bone during healing.
- Physical therapy: To restore mobility and strength after the infection resolves.

Prevention
While not all cases of Yersinia-associated osteomyelitis can be prevented, you can reduce your risk by:
Food Safety
- Cook pork thoroughly (to at least 145°F or 63°C).
- Avoid unpasteurized milk or dairy products.
- Wash fruits and vegetables thoroughly before eating.
- Practice good hygiene, such as washing hands before handling food.
General Hygiene
- Wash hands frequently, especially after using the bathroom or handling raw meat.
- Avoid close contact with individuals who have gastrointestinal infections.
Managing Underlying Conditions
- Keep chronic illnesses (e.g., diabetes, liver disease) well-controlled.
- Work with your doctor to manage iron overload disorders.
- Stay up-to-date on vaccinations to support overall immune health.
Complications
If left untreated, Yersinia-associated osteomyelitis can lead to serious complications, including:
- Chronic osteomyelitis: A long-term infection that is difficult to cure and may require repeated surgeries.
- Bone necrosis: Death of bone tissue due to lack of blood supply.
- Septic arthritis: Spread of infection to nearby joints, causing pain and stiffness.
- Pathological fractures: Bones weakened by infection may break more easily.
- Sepsis: A life-threatening condition where the infection spreads throughout the body.
- Growth disturbances: In children, infection near growth plates can stunt bone growth.
Early diagnosis and treatment are critical to preventing these complications.
